Web1 nov. 2024 · To begin the reset process, open the Settings app on your Windows 11 PC. Do this by pressing Windows+i keys at the same time. In Settings, from the left sidebar, select “System.”. On the “System” page, click “Recovery.”. In the “Recovery” menu, next to “Reset this PC,” click “Reset PC.”. You will see a “Reset this PC ... Web25 okt. 2024 · Download Article. 1. From here, you can select your preferred cleaning option, … how to run archive in outlook 365Web3 nov. 2024 · From the Apple menu in the corner of your screen, choose System Settings. Click General in the sidebar. Click Transfer or Reset on the right. Click Erase All Content and Settings.
